Lets compare vitamin content per 100 grams of Frozen Chopped Broccoli vs Tofu, soft, prepared with calcium sulfate and magnesium chloride (nigari):
- 100 grams of Frozen Chopped Broccoli have more Vitamin A, 2.6 times more Vitamin B2, 5.5 times more Vitamin B5, 2.5 times more Vitamin B6, 1.5 times more Vitamin B9, 282 times more Vitamin C, 122 times more Vitamin E and 40.6 times more Vitamin K than Tofu, soft, prepared with calcium sulfate and magnesium chloride (nigari).
- Both Frozen Chopped Broccoli and Tofu, soft, prepared with calcium sulfate and magnesium chloride (nigari) provide similar amounts of Vitamin B1 and Vitamin B3 per 100 grams.
- 100 grams of Tofu, soft, prepared with calcium sulfate and magnesium chloride (nigari) have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A, Vitamin B5, Vitamin C, Vitamin E and Vitamin K
- Both Frozen Chopped Broccoli, Unprepared as well as Tofu, soft, prepared with calcium sulfate and magnesium chloride (nigari) have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12 and Vitamin D in 100 grams.
Comparing minerals per 100 grams for Frozen Chopped Broccoli vs Tofu, soft, prepared with calcium sulfate and magnesium chloride (nigari):
- 100 grams of Frozen Chopped Broccoli have 1.8 times more Potassium than Tofu, soft, prepared with calcium sulfate and magnesium chloride (nigari).
- While 100 g of Tofu, soft, prepared with calcium sulfate and magnesium chloride (nigari) contain 2 times more Calcium, 4.1 times more Copper, 1.4 times more Iron, 1.5 times more Magnesium, 1.3 times more Manganese, 1.8 times more Phosphorus, 3.2 times more Selenium and 1.3 times more Zinc than Frozen Chopped Broccoli, Unprepared.
- Both Frozen Chopped Broccoli and Tofu, soft, prepared with calcium sulfate and magnesium chloride (nigari) contain similar levels of Water per 100 grams.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 100 grams:
- 100 grams of Frozen Chopped Broccoli have 4.1 times more Carbohydrate and 15 times more Fiber than Tofu, soft, prepared with calcium sulfate and magnesium chloride (nigari).
- While 100 g of Tofu, soft, prepared with calcium sulfate and magnesium chloride (nigari) contain 2.3 times more Energy, 12.7 times more Fat, 2.3 times more Omega 3, 59.2 times more Omega 6 and 2.6 times more Protein than Frozen Chopped Broccoli, Unprepared.
